概括
聊天GPT生成的临床图片和多选题 (MCQ) 的质量与医学教育中人类撰写的材料相美. 一些MCQ表现出可接受的心理测量属性进行评估.

背景情况:
- 像ChatGPT这样的人工智能 (AI) 工具的整合为教育内容生成提供了新的可能性.
- 在现实世界的教育环境中评估人工智能产生的材料的有效性对于采用至关重要.
- 基于证据的医学培训需要高质量的临床病例和评估.
研究的目的:
- 评估由ChatGPT创建的临床小题和多项选择题 (MCQ) 的现实表现.
- 将ChatGPT生成的教育材料的质量与人类撰写的内容进行比较.
- 评估人工智能生成的MCQ的心理测量特性,用于医学教育评估.
主要方法:
- 一项随机对照研究,涉及74名医学学生参加基于证据的医学培训计划.
- 两组被分配:一个接收了ChatGPT生成的案例,另一个接收了人类编写的案例.
- 参与者使用利克特尺度评估病例质量,并完成ChatGPT生成的MCQ;分析了心理测量特征.
主要成果:
- 在ChatGPT和对照组之间的病例评估中没有发现显著差异 (p > .05).
- 在ChatGPT生成的15个MCQ中,只有6个具有可接受的点-双序列相关性 (>0.30).
- 五个MCQ满足了课堂评估的可接受标准,表明部分心理测量有效性.
结论:
- 通过ChatGPT生成的临床图片在质量上与人类撰写的相似.
- 一些人工智能生成的MCQ具有可接受的心理测量特征用于教育评估.
- 聊天GPT证明了在医疗教育中创建用于教学的临床图片和用于评估的MCQ的潜力.

Randomized Experiments
6.9K
The randomization process involves assigning study participants randomly to experimental or control groups based on their probability of being equally assigned. Randomization is meant to eliminate selection bias and balance known and unknown confounding factors so that the control group is similar to the treatment group as much as possible. A computer program and a random number generator can be used to assign participants to groups in a way that minimizes bias.

Blinding
2.4K
Blinding is a commonly used method of not telling participants which treatment a subject is receiving. Blinding is a critical part of a randomized control trial or RCT. It reduces the bias that affects the results. In an RCT, blinding is used in the form of a placebo. A placebo effect occurs when untreated subjects falsely believe they have received the treatment and report improved symptoms. A placebo or a dummy treatment is administered to subjects to negate the bias caused by such an effect.

Crossover Experiments
2.8K
Crossover experiments, also called the repeated-measurements design, is a study design in which all experimental units are exposed to all treatments in different periods. Crossover experiments are generally used in psychology, the pharmaceutical industry, agriculture, and medicine.
Crossover designs are performed even with smaller sample sizes since the samples can act as their controls. These are better than simple randomized trials since patients are exposed to all the treatments.
